Default Where are good living areas/nice size towns between Chattanooga and Huntville, Alabama?

Possible job opeing in the Huntsville area but love the Tennessee area in South Eastern Tennessee. Any suggestions on possible commute towns in between?

Fayetteville seems to be a popular town for those who want to live in Tennessee and commute to Huntsville. It's a small-ish town but is only 20-30 minutes from Huntsville.

Huntland is a reallllllly small town 25-30 miles NE of Huntsville but in Franklin County, TN. It has a small K-12 school which is one of the best in the county, rolling to flat farmland, to large hills.. A town parade at Christmas and 4th of July.... 3 red lights.... and they are all on the water tower...
